Learn the Meaning of the Sun Tarot Card

Home / Tarot / Learn the Meaning of the Sun Tarot Card

The Sun Tarot card is one of the strongest in the deck – one which reflects positivity, fun, warmth, and success in its upright position. A member of the Major Arcana cards, this card can put a powerful influence into any of your readings – as it has done throughout history.

About the Sun Tarot Card

The Sun Tarot card is warm, inviting, and powerful – much like the sun itself. Most decks depict some image of the sun, shining brightly and bringing life to the planet.

In the classic Rider-Waite deck, as well as many others, the card depicts a young, naked boy sitting atop a horse. The sun shines down on him and sunflowers flourish in the background. This is a bright and joyous image that reflects the meaning of the card.

Like other cards, the meaning of the Sun card varies depending on whether it is pulled upright or in reverse.

The Sun Upright

When pulled upright, the Sun Tarot card reflects joy, positivity, strength, and success. The sun is the source of life, an invigorating and powerful influence that guides all things to success and strength.

The flowers, flourishing so brightly in the card, represent the abundance provided by the sun. This may suggest that you are about to enter a stage of abundance and success, or that your own inner abundance is becoming a source of power in your life.

The sun represents that you are capable of overcoming challenges, influencing your life and others with the strength of light, and that you are capable of bringing and receiving joy, energy, and excitement.

The Sun Reversed

When reversed, the Sun card indicates that you may be in need of harnessing your own personal power.

The Sun Reversed also indicates that you need to release your inner child. As adults, it becomes all too easy to get caught up in responsibilities. The Sun Reversed calls upon us to honor our inner child and act on our own power and capability as individuals.

The Sun Reversed may also indicate a lack of light. Perhaps you have become jaded or pessimistic in your pursuits, or perhaps you are faced with individuals or situations which compromise your own inner light.

The Sun, regardless of its direction, reminds you that we always contain the inner resources needed to overcome strife and to bring light into our lives. When reversed, the Sun suggests that you may have temporarily lost sight of these resources.

Or, the Sun Reversed may suggest that you are becoming overconfident or that you are surpassing your own ability to cope. Perhaps you have bitten off more than you can chew or you have dedicated more time and energy to something than you can justly do without becoming drained.

Conclusion

The Sun Tarot is a powerful and optimistic card, one which reminds us that we always contain the capacity for success within ourselves. Reversed or upright, this card reminds us to let our inner child run free and never to forget about our own capabilities.
